  4. Having a disability NEVER became cool, Poppy; being cruel did.

    So, I saw a weird headline on social media today: “How having a disability became cool“. Oh dear lord, here we go again. Another author of “news” that is entirely made up… Deep sigh.

    Poppy Coburn, Associate Comment Editor for The Telegraph, takes a pop at the “‘sickfluencers’, are turning chronic illness into a lifestyle trend”. Except the only ones using that word are news outlets trying to sell newspapers. It’s made up.

    Two years on, there’s an avalanche of results talking about it. The thing is, all of those pages and pages of news articles are all quoting each other. It’s as if a whole trend has been summoned into being just so the people summoning it can be outraged.

    Another title for this might have been: Why is the press so keen to demonise my people? Because the right-leaning whiney-bitch newspapers (such as The Sun and The Daily Mail) lead the charge in attacking people with mental health issues, coining the term “sickfluencer” back in 2024.

    Disabled people living with mental health conditions came on the receiving end of an exponential surge in corporate media attacks against benefit claimants in 2024.

    REVEALED: MSM disproportionately targets mental health-related DWP claimants in attack articles

    This is the thing, there’s no such thing as a “sickfluencer”. It’s a BS term that the panic merchants want to sell you because hate and panic make money.

    The DWP already apply rigorous means testing. Under the Conservatives, they turned that assessment up to 11 to placate the Daily Mail. The result was chaos, suffering, and deaths. There’s no free ride on benefits.

    The mind boggles that people believe that sick people are getting £60,000. If that were the case, where’s my cash? Oh, right, it doesn’t exist.

    Under both Conservative and Labour governments, the DWP have colluded with the press to demonise younger claimants living with mental health issues, ADHD and autism. Ministers have joined in, to create a smokescreen which obscures the politically inconvenient truth that the majority of those at risk of losing their personal independence payment (PIP) under the Green paper proposals are older people with physical health conditions – many of whom have worked all their adult life until they became ill.

    Mental health PIP claimants demonised as cover for massive assault on physical health awards

    Being disabled isn’t “suddenly cool”. The truth that so frightened these journalists is that suffering in silence is a thing of the past. I certainly gave up struggling unseen – I started a whole blog about it.

    Just because I picked up a physical disability, it doesn’t make the mental health crap I suffer from any less real. Now I get a pass because I have a “real” disability. I’ve got a strange brain and a broken body – that’s twice as hard, not easier.

    I’m not sitting back in my mansion raking in piles of cash. I’m spending money I don’t have to try and live my life somewhat normally. Yeah, I get a bit of PIP. It’s not a fortune. It covers a few cabs and some assistance. Just like everyone else, I have to budget as well as I can to get by. I am not part of the have-yachts; I’m part of the have-to-be-careful crew. Same as most everyone else.

    Rather than reposting two-year-old Daily Mail BS, can we not have a journalist with a shred of journalistic integrity willing to call out the snowballing lie? But no. Apparently, Poppy would rather repeat the attack line given to her by the hate media just so there’s someone the rabid crowd can point out as “the reason things are bad”.

    If the billionaire newspaper owners can get you hating the poor and the sick, maybe you won’t notice that they were the ones that fucked up the world.

    Struggling weirdo’s like me are not the reason for the cost of living. We’re not trying to be cool. You are being lied to by the 1% through the mouthpiece of the likes of Poppy Coburn.

    To end on a better note, here is a podcast taking a more level-headed approach to the silly headlines, including a guest who was on the direct receiving end of it.

  12. P. Diddy : Le rappeur agressé en prison, la gorge presque tranchée

    Sean « Diddy » Combs aurait échappé de peu à un drame derrière les barreaux. Selon plusieurs sources concordantes, le producteur américain aurait été victime d’une agression violente dans sa cellule au centre de détention de Brooklyn. Un incident grave qui relance les inquiétudes autour de sa sécurité et de sa détention.

    Un épisode de terreur dans la cellule du magnat du hip-hop

    Une nuit d’angoisse au MDC Brooklyn

    Selon les informations révélées par TMZ et confirmées par le Daily Mail, une scène digne d’un film d’action s’est déroulée au Metropolitan Detention Center (MDC) de Brooklyn, où Sean Combs purge actuellement sa peine. En pleine nuit, un détenu se serait introduit dans sa cellule, avant de lui appuyer un couteau contre la gorge alors qu’il dormait.

    Le témoignage glaçant de son ami Charlucci Finney

    C’est Charlucci Finney, un proche du rappeur, qui a révélé les détails de cet épisode effrayant. Il raconte que Diddy se serait réveillé en sursaut, la lame déjà posée sur sa peau. L’intervention rapide d’un gardien aurait permis d’éviter le pire. « Je ne sais pas s’il a eu le temps de se défendre, ou si les surveillants sont intervenus immédiatement », a déclaré Finney. Cet incident, selon lui, a profondément choqué le personnel pénitentiaire et les autres détenus.

    La prison de Brooklyn, un environnement à haut risque

    Un lieu dangereux pour les détenus médiatisés

    Toujours selon Charlucci Finney, cette agression serait davantage une intimidation qu’une tentative d’assassinat. « La prison n’est pas un endroit sûr pour quelqu’un impliqué dans une affaire de mœurs », a-t-il souligné, rappelant la réputation redoutable du MDC Brooklyn, souvent pointé du doigt pour sa violence interne. Pour l’entourage du producteur, cet événement met en lumière l’urgence d’un transfert vers un établissement plus sûr.

    L’avocat de Diddy alerte sur les conditions de détention

    Lors de l’audience de détermination de la peine, Brian Steel, l’avocat du producteur, avait déjà mentionné cet incident, affirmant qu’un gardien avait réussi à désarmer l’agresseur juste à temps. Me Steel insiste désormais sur la nécessité de changer Diddy de prison pour garantir sa sécurité, soulignant que son client est « une cible permanente en raison de sa notoriété ».

    Les demandes de transfert et la quête d’une grâce présidentielle

    Diddy réclame son transfert vers Fort Dix

    Depuis cet incident, l’équipe juridique de Sean Combs a formulé une requête officielle pour qu’il soit transféré au centre correctionnel de Fort Dix, dans le New Jersey. Ce lieu, jugé plus adapté, lui permettrait de suivre un programme de traitement pour ses addictions tout en facilitant les visites familiales. Les avocats insistent également sur les conditions de sécurité plus favorables qu’offre ce centre fédéral.

    Un espoir de clémence présidentielle

    En parallèle, Diddy aurait renouvelé sa demande de grâce présidentielle auprès de Donald Trump, qu’il avait déjà sollicitée auparavant. Selon son entourage, cette démarche reflète autant sa peur d’un nouvel incident que son espoir d’obtenir une réduction de peine. L’ancien président, souvent bienveillant envers certaines figures publiques, n’a toutefois pas encore réagi publiquement à cette demande.

    Une condamnation lourde et une réputation écornée

    Un verdict sévère mais des accusations partiellement écartées

    Pour rappel, Sean Combs a été condamné à 50 mois de prison, soit un peu plus de quatre ans, après avoir été reconnu coupable de deux violations de la Mann Act, une loi fédérale interdisant le transport de personnes à des fins de prostitution. En revanche, il a été acquitté des chefs plus graves de trafic sexuel et de racket, ce qui lui a évité une peine bien plus lourde.
